Mastering Beatdown Decks in Tower Rush

If Cycle decks are a surgeon's scalpel and Siege decks are a sniper rifle, the 'Beatdown' archetype is a massive, blunt sledgehammer.


You must be willing to sacrifice the health of your own towers to build an overwhelming elixir advantage.


Taking Smart Damage


If you spend 4 elixir defending a 3-elixir Goblin Barrel, you will never accumulate the massive reserves needed to deploy your 8-elixir Golem.


You are intentionally losing the battle in the first two minutes to guarantee that you win the war in the final minute.

The Unstoppable Push


As the tank trudges forward, absorbing all the tower shots and defensive spells, your support units safely annihilate anything in their path.


You must build a synergistic support squad that covers every possible defensive response the opponent might have.


Primary Win ConditionHow it Differs
The Golem (8 Elixir)The heaviest, slowest investment; requires the most sacrifice but creates the most unstoppable push when fully supported
The Giant (5 Elixir)Cheaper and faster, allowing for more aggressive, mid-game pushes and significantly better defensive utility
